noun

Meaning 1

A version of a song that is a new performance or rerecording of that song by a different artist.

noun

Meaning 2

a recording of a song that was first recorded or made popular by somebody else

Definition source: Princeton WordNet 3.0

Examples

  • they made a cover of a Beatles' song
